Bond's formula with the new feed size.power consumption equation of vertical roller mill,Vertical Roller Mills for Finish Grinding | Industrial Efficiency .Energy savings enabled by replacing ball mills with VRMs can be 20 to 30% and is primarily a function of the product fineness. . In China, replacement of ball mills with vertical roller mills in finish grinding can reduce energy consumption by 10 to 15 kWh/t-cement, representing a saving between 30 to 40% (MIIT, 2012. p.

The remaining energy consumption at cement plants is used for final-product packaging, lighting, and building services. These are typically minor electricity uses compared to the major electricity and fuel consumption in the five major process steps. 1 Clinker can be produced in many different pyroprocessing systems or kiln.
